使用详细教程

随着互联网监管的不断加强,网站域名备案信息的实时监测显得尤为重要。通过API接口服务,可以方便快捷地实现对域名备案状态的实时查询与监控,大大提升了网站管理的效率与合规保障。本文将为您详细介绍如何使用实时域名备案检测API接口服务,逐步带您完成整个操作流程,并提醒在使用中常见的误区和优化建议,确保您能够轻松上手,快速部署。

第一步:了解实时域名备案检测API的基本功能和优势

在开始对接API之前,您需要明确其主要用途和价值所在。实时域名备案检测API的核心功能包括:

  • 快速查询域名是否已经完成备案
  • 实时同步备案状态变更,确保数据的时效性
  • 支持批量域名检测,提升检测效率
  • 返回数据格式清晰,方便程序解析和后续处理
  • 提供稳定的接口访问,满足企业级应用需求

理解以上特点后,您才能更准确地确定此服务是否符合自身需求,同时也为后续的技术对接打下基础。

第二步:注册并获取API访问权限

要使用实时域名备案检测API,第一步必须是申请成为服务提供平台的用户。通常流程如下:

  1. 注册账号:访问API服务商官网,填写邮箱、手机号及其它相关信息完成注册。
  2. 身份验证:根据平台规则,进行身份验证,有的平台需上传身份证明文件以确保信息真实。
  3. 申请API权限:登录后在“开发者中心”或“API管理”区域提交API申请,通常需要填写应用名称、用途说明等。
  4. 获取API Key和Secret:审核通过后,平台会为您生成唯一的API密钥和密钥串,这些信息将用于接口调用的身份认证。

温馨提示:务必妥善保存您的API密钥,切勿泄露给第三方,避免因密钥泄漏造成接口滥用甚至经济损失。

第三步:阅读API接口文档,熟悉请求参数与响应格式

API文档是您对接以及二次开发的指南。建议您重点关注以下内容:

  • 接口请求地址:明确每个功能对应的URL地址。
  • 请求方式:是GET、POST还是其他方式,确保正确发送请求。
  • 身份验证参数:如API Key、Token以及签名机制的使用方法。
  • 请求参数说明:常见的是域名列表、检测类型等,明确必传与可选参数。
  • 响应数据结构:包括成功返回的备案信息字段,错误码及描述,帮助您解析接口反馈。
  • 调用频率限制:例如每日调用上限、每秒最大QPS,防止接口被封禁。

如果文档中附带示例代码,建议认真揣摩,结合您自身开发环境尝试执行。

第四步:准备开发环境,编写测试代码

选择您习惯的编程语言(如Python、Java、PHP、JavaScript等),然后进行接口测试开发。

以下是使用Python调用实时域名备案检测API的示例代码思路:

import requests

API地址
url = "https://api.example.com/domain/icp_check"

请求参数,示例传入域名列表
payload = {
    "domains": ["example.com", "testsite.cn"],
    "api_key": "您的API密钥"
}

发送POST请求
response = requests.post(url, json=payload)

解析响应
if response.status_code == 200:
    data = response.json
    if data["success"]:
        for domain_info in data["result"]:
            print(f"域名: {domain_info['domain']}, 备案状态: {domain_info['status']}")
    else:
        print(f"接口返回错误: {data['message']}")
else:
    print("请求失败,状态码:", response.status_code)
  

运行时,确保网络通畅且API密钥正确无误。

常见错误提示:

  • 401 Unauthorized:一般是密钥错误或未传递身份认证参数。
  • 400 Bad Request:请求参数格式不正确。
  • 429 Too Many Requests:频率超过限制,需要适当控制调用间隔时间。

第五步:集成API,实现实时备案状态监控

完成测试后,您可以将API调用代码整合进您的管理系统,实现:

  • 网站新增备案自动检测,防止未备案网站上线
  • 定时批量同步备案状态,保持数据更新
  • 异常或未备案自动告警,第一时间干预处理
  • 用户自主查询界面,提升服务的专业性和透明度

针对不同业务需求,设计合理的调用频率和数据存储策略,避免不必要的重复查询,减轻服务器压力。

第六步:常见问题及操作建议

1. 接口调用频率控制不足导致被限流

API服务通常对请求频率有限制,建议加装调用节流机制,比如合理设置时间间隔或采用队列处理,保证请求稳定且高效。

2. 错误处理不完善导致程序崩溃

务必在代码中添加异常捕获逻辑,如网络异常、JSON解析错误等,以增强系统稳定性。

3. 备案信息数据延迟或不准确

虽然是“实时”检测,受第三方数据更新机制限制,个别备案信息可能存在一定延迟。可与服务供应商确认更新频度,必要时进行人工核实。

4. API密钥安全管理不当

密钥泄露会带来安全风险。建议密钥存储使用环境变量或安全库,避免硬编码在前端或被泄露的代码库。

5. 多域名批量查询性能瓶颈

批量查询时分批发送请求或采用异步处理,避免单请求域名过多导致Timeout或响应缓慢。

第七步:优化升级及长期维护

API对接完成后,持续关注新版本发布与功能迭代,及时优化您的系统:

  • 根据新接口支持的字段增加业务功能
  • 结合大数据分析,预测备案变更趋势,优化管理决策
  • 完善用户界面,提供多样化查询与报表导出
  • 建立完善的日志机制,保障数据安全与追溯

此外,定期评估合作API服务商的稳定性和服务质量,避免影响业务连续性。

总结

实时域名备案检测API接口服务,为网站备案管理提供了极大的便利和可靠保障。只要您按照以上详细步骤操作,避免常见错误,便能快速实现高效稳定的备案信息监测系统,从容应对日益严格的互联网合规要求。无论是个人站长还是企业用户,掌握并灵活运用此类接口技术,都将显著提升管理水平和响应速度。

祝您使用愉快,网站安全合规飞速提升!